Elderkin, Edwin “Ed” L., age 74 of Grand Marsh

 

“Ed” Edwin L. Elderkin, Grand Marsh Wisconsin, passed away peacefully after a courageous battle with cancer at UW Hospital on January, 13, 2018 surrounded by his loving wife and family.
Ed was born on Nov. 10, 1943 to Leland and Doris (VanAlstine) Elderkin. He attended school in WI Dells.

Ed’s favorite memories were his childhood time spent with Grandpa swimming & fishing daily in the WI River with his dog.  Ed loved fast/loud cars when he was young.  Ed worked at Greenwood’s Garage, Kilbourn Machine, and Logged for many years. It was well known Ed could repair or fix just about anything.  When Ed Retired he started running his own farming operation for several years and proved he could grow corn with the best of ‘em.  He loved to weld and make things, watch his crops and garden grow. He enjoyed rides around the farm in the UTV with Diane and their dog Maggie. He could be found many afternoons out socializing, where he enjoyed meeting people and discussing anything from farming, machines, and the weather to politics. Ed will be greatly missed by the many people he came to know.
